WebMany people with hypermobile joints do not have any problems or need treatment. However, joint hypermobility can sometimes cause unpleasant symptoms, such as: joint pain. back pain. dislocated joints – when the joint comes out if its correct position. soft tissue injuries, such as. tenosynovitis. WebMay 9, 2024 · Can Ehlers-Danlos syndrome cause arthritis? The specific EDS type most associated with arthritis is hypermobility type (hEDS). This type is known for frequent joint dislocation, degenerative joint disease and chronic pain. The diagnosis of one of the Ehlers-Danlos syndrome is based on the findings of a medical history and physical exam.
